Helicopter crew rescues pilot and student from crashed plane in Florida Everglades
This is the dramatic moment a helicopter crew rescued a pilot and a student after their plane crashed in Florida.
Miami-Dade Fire Rescue teams were dispatched following reports of the incident in a remote area of the Everglades, around 20 miles west of Miami Executive Airport.
Air Rescue units combed the vast wetlands and located two individuals who had managed to exit the downed Cessna 172M Skyhawk, operated by Pilot Training Centre LLC.
Due to the rugged terrain and isolation of the site, teams performed a hoist operation to lift the pair to safety.
Footage captures emergency responders carrying out the high-stakes rescue on Tuesday, October 7, at 2:44 pm.
Authorities confirmed that neither sustained injuries. The duo were airlifted back to Miami Executive Airport following the rescue.
The cause of the crash has not yet been determined, and an investigation is underway.
